Pheonix Riding Club had a great turn out on Sunday for their Dressage Day with somewhat cooler conditions than the last few Sunday events.

UYPC Beginners Gymkhana date is set for June 25, this was great fun last year and is open to all novice and beginner riders, lots of fun events and some novelty races, a handymount course and everyone’s favourite Fancy Dress. Great prizes and a really fun day. All questions from those just starting out and enquiries are welcome to contact Anita 0409 953 345.

If any local Pony Clubs are interested, an expression of interest notice is being put out for a Showjumping Weekend competition starting next year, asking if any Clubs would like to run a ring as a fundraiser for their Club and to ensure we have plenty of events on offer for those travelling long distances. The Hi-point winner for the weekend would win the Stephen O’Reilly Memorial Trophy that has recently been

returned. Please chat to Anita with any questions or to raise any interest in participating.

Camping and yards are available and there is plenty of arena space to run multiple rings simultaneously.

Sponsorship for events is always hard, and after Covid lockdowns, it seemed to get even harder, but some local businesses have been so generous still to all the local clubs’ events, so the clubs would like to say a huge thank-you on behalf of all competitors, club committees and club members for the amazing support that they continue to receive.
